Why did Shakespeare use the sonnet form for the prologue?

Respuesta :

kuliadaniela14 kuliadaniela14
  • 08-06-2021

Answer:

In Romeo and Juliet, Shakespeare presents the Prologue as a sonnet in order to point to the play's themes of love and the feud because sonnets were often used to address the subject of love in conflict.
